Could some expert please explain this? When I use EDR to design heat exchangers, the actual area obtained is always much larger than the required area. Moreover, the flow velocity in the shell side is too low, while the flow velocity in the tube side is too high. What’s going on?
Reply #22023-06-10
The process of selecting a heat exchanger is a relatively complex one that requires taking many factors into consideration. The reasons for the situation you described could be as follows: 1. Improper selection of the heat exchanger: It is possible that a heat exchanger with an excessively high rated heat transfer capacity was chosen, resulting in an actual area that is much larger than what is required. It is also possible that the number of tubes in the tube side or shell side does not match, resulting in unreasonable flow rates. 2. Inaccurate fluid parameters: Fluid parameters include fluid temperature, flow rate, physical properties, etc. If these parameters are estimated inaccurately, it will lead to an inappropriate selection of the heat exchanger, which in turn affects its operation. 3. The operating conditions of the heat exchanger differ from the design conditions: In actual use, there may be operating conditions that are different from those specified in the design, such as flow rate, pressure, and temperature. Changes in these conditions may cause the actual operating conditions to differ from the design conditions. To address the above issues, it is necessary to carefully analyze the root causes of the problems before making a selection, and to conduct reasonable estimates and calculations for various parameters in advance, in order to ensure the accuracy of the heat exchanger selection. At the same time, in practical use, it is also necessary to closely monitor the entire process and adjust the operating parameters of the heat exchanger in a timely manner to achieve the optimal heat exchange effect. .
